1. Current Aluminum Scrap Prices in Texas (Per Pound)
Prices vary by aluminum type and region. Here are the average rates as of mid-2024:
Type of Aluminum Scrap | Price Per Pound (USD) |
---|---|
Aluminum Cans (Clean) | $0.30 – $0.55 |
Aluminum Wire (Stripped) | $0.40 – $0.75 |
Aluminum Extrusions | $0.50 – $0.85 |
Aluminum Sheet (Clean) | $0.45 – $0.70 |
Aluminum Radiators | $0.25 – $0.50 |
Mixed/Dirty Aluminum | $0.10 – $0.30 |
Prices fluctuate daily—check with local recyclers for exact rates.
2. Factors Affecting Aluminum Prices in Texas
A. Global Market Trends
Prices follow the London Metal Exchange (LME)
Increased demand from automotive, aerospace, and packaging industries impacts rates
B. Regional Differences in Texas
Houston/Dallas: Higher demand from industrial sectors may increase prices
Border Cities (El Paso/Laredo): Export activity can influence local rates
Rural Areas: Prices may be slightly lower due to reduced competition
C. Fuel & Transportation Costs
Rising diesel prices can slightly reduce scrap payouts
D. Aluminum Quality & Preparation
Clean, sorted aluminum fetches 20-30% higher prices
Crushed cans or stripped wire often get better rates

4. How to Get the Best Price for Aluminum Scrap?
✅ Sort by Type – Separate cans, wire, and extrusions
✅ Clean Thoroughly – Remove dirt, plastic, and other contaminants
✅ Sell in Bulk – Larger quantities (100+ lbs) often get better rates
✅ Time Your Sale – Prices often rise in Q3/Q4 due to manufacturing demand
✅ Bring Proper ID – Texas law requires scrap sellers to provide identification
